The Beatles  "We Can Work It Out/Day Tripper"

This is a US vinyl single from 1965 on Capitol 5555.    These were originally non-LP songs.     But, they soon came out on their "Yesterday And Today" album.     'We Can Work It Out' went to # 1 on 12/18/65 and stayed there for 3 weeks.    It comes in it's original picture sleeve.   This has the West coast variation with the thumb tab.   The labels are the yellow/orange swirl.    This is the first pressing with no sing timings on the labels.    It's hard to find this with mint vinyl.
